You've been on ottersccustoms... :D I think the feedneck is a checkit products surefit feedneck. Tap a set screw thread halfway down the trigger to shorten the pull, and replace the spring with a pen spring (like tippys, haha) My did it too, it looks more like a blade, but it's brass coloured now. EDIT: Try a tornado valve, spring kit, then a real lightning bolt. Edited by Ashran |
